TAROM is reducing its fleet by selling four Boeing 737-700 aircraft and will receive new leased aircraft.

The National Company of Romanian Air Transport TAROM has decided to sell the four Boeing 737-700 aircraft, purchased between 2001 and 2004, as part of a restructuring plan approved at the Extraordinary General Meeting of Shareholders on February 10, 2026. The general director has been mandated to finalize the transaction, and the planes will be put up for auction. Since the beginning of the restructuring process in 2018, TAROM has sold 17 aircraft, obtaining over 54 million euros. Currently, TAROM's fleet includes 14 aircraft, and the company will receive two new leased Boeing 737-8s this summer. The sale of the planes is part of a broader fleet modernization plan, which also includes the intention to lease four Boeing 737-MAX 8 aircraft. The main shareholders of TAROM are the Romanian State (98.01%) and other entities with minor stakes. The decision to sell was adopted with an overwhelming majority, having only one abstention.
